Abstract

A solid polymer electrolyte is prepared by forming a polymer solution containing a filler into a film, evaporating off the solvent from the film, and impregnating the film with an electrolytic solution. The impregnated polymer electrolyte has a swelling factor of at least 2.2. The method is efficient enough to produce the polymer electrolyte at a low cost. The polymer electrolyte is useful in electrochemical devices such as lithium secondary batteries and electric double layer capacitors.
